When in conversation, people say “that’s a great question” – I used to wonder in my head “really”. Different ways people make a flow in the talking going. What a great question, really good one, thank you for asking, and my head goes ???????. Now I have stopped asking any question, surely not literally but I make statements now. Speakers take time processing it in their heads. It is a good way to buy that extra few seconds. Don’t get me wrong we all need that few seconds to think and we still have questions and should ask them. When somebody told me- what a good question I used to feel I must be so intelligent at least now I don’t get elated to think – hah me and my intelligence. I am more grounded now and still happy without that good question.
